You are waiting to join college after your KCSE examination. While reading a newspaper, you see an advertisement for a volunteer worker at a children’s home. Write a letter of inquiry to the manager. Express your interest and inquire if they will pay any allowances and whether they can provide accommodation. Remember to quote the reference number of the advertisement

Must be a letter – a formal/official letter of inquiry. If not deduct up to 4 marks.

Must have:

1. Sender address 1 mark

2. Date 1 mark

3. Addressee’s address 1 mark

4. Salutation ½ marks

If the word dear is missing, deny a mark

5. Reference/title ½ marks

6. Body

- Expression of interest 2 mks

- Age, sex, qualification 3 mks

- Inquiry about allowances and accommodation 4 mks

- Reference number of advert 1 mark

7. Complimentary close/closure (Yours faithfully) ½ marks

8. Name and signature of sender ½ marks

If there is only signature of sender, deny a mark

If there is name without signature, accept
